  7. chiefwvfc

    Rate of Dissolved Gas Increase

    Also, time of day can make a difference in the sample results, we have seen that samples late in the afternoon after the sun has heated the transformer will result in higher gas levels then those in the morning. This is also due to the fact that the samples are taken from the bottom of the...

    Doble Testing

    A doble test is a power factor test, and there are several suppliers of PF test equipment, such as: Doble, Megger, and On-line Monitoring Inc.
